Friends, acquaintances, and family members often ask Molly and me to take a look at manuscripts they have written. Each one represents a quest for the Great American Novel or the non-fiction Great American Equivalent. Each one tells a fine story; each one is in need of a publisher. Our problem is not the quality of the work presented to us–it is the quantity. We are discovering the overwhelming number of original, enlightening stories that deserve publication. And we are a small press. We simply cannot publish all the fine manuscripts presented to us. So we are wracking our brains for ways to help new authors get published, and have come up with the idea of a Synergetic Alliance, modeled in some sense on the process that gave birth to Fuze Publishing.
Forming a Synergetic Alliance would begin with several trusting writer friends. It would involve the pooling of their resources, both financial and creative. Given the importance of design in bookmaking and web-site development, the group might include a visual artist. At least one person with superb editorial skills, one with accounting skills, and one with Internet skills should round out the mix. The group would then commit to critiquing, rewriting, and finally bringing out the work of its members, one by one. If this approach appeals to you, please check our web site in a couple of weeks.
